The Cost Of Short Term Drug Rehab in Upper Falls, Maryland

Most individuals struggling with substance abuse and addiction typically feel the cost of treatment and rehabilitation is too expensive. As a result, they might decide to forgo treatment - not realizing that addiction is typically more expensive in the long-term.

Contingent on the type of treatment you decide on, you can be sure that the facility will need you to take care of the costs up front. However, there are affordable treatment programs in Upper Falls that you can take advantage of to reduce these costs - one of these is short term drug rehab.

Short term drug treatment is usually more affordable than long-term rehabilitation because you will only participate in the program for a limited period. Therefore, you finally have a less expensive alternative that you can count on to help you resolve your substance abuse and addiction.

In some cases, you may even find that your health insurance carrier will pay for the cost of rehabilitation if you choose short term drug treatment. Yet, some insurances have limitations on the total amount they may pay out - or the entire number of days in treatment that they will pay for. Still, most short term rehab programs are fully covered by insurance.

Thus, if the cost of treatment is a significant deciding factor for you, short term rehabilitation may be the best way forward. As much as you might want to receive the most effective, most intensive form of treatment, your budget might hinder you from selecting other treatment options such as long term drug and alcohol treatment.

Even with this somewhat low cost, short term treatment may work for you. Yet, the success of the treatment will primarily depend on you as an individual. If your substance abuse has been going on for a long period of time, for instance, it is highly unlikely that this duration of treatment will be successful in the long-run for you. This is because it is better suited for people who have only just started showing signs of substance abuse.

Overall, short term drug rehab is most appropriate for addicts who have not been abusing drugs or alcohol for a long time and for those who cannot come up with the funds for a longer stay in an addiction treatment facility.
